Output 171620b9dedb36fd5daf9c34b0f2f8c80b1515a6490c26b68f5e4e2abdc9017a:0

value
100287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c45c812652cfc1767686bf3848af8b523de84ff OP_EQUAL
address
38eJsdQvZrQq7BhTrnr99UjxiN8xp4o84H
transaction
171620b9dedb36fd5daf9c34b0f2f8c80b1515a6490c26b68f5e4e2abdc9017a
spent
true